how to start affiliate marketing for beginners

How To Start Affiliate Marketing For Beginners

Disclaimer: We receive affiliate compensation rom some of the links below at no cost to you. You can read our full affiliate disclosure in our privacy policy.

Are you a beginner looking to get into the world of affiliate marketing but don’t know where to start? Well, you’re in luck! Affiliate marketing is an incredibly lucrative business model and one that can be started with minimal upfront costs. With this guide, you’ll learn everything about affiliate marketing – from understanding what it is and how it works all the way through to setting up your website and gaining potential customers. In short, we’ll walk you through every step of launching your very own successful affiliate marketing business!

What is affiliate marketing, and how does it work

Affiliate marketing is a strategy where an individual partners with a business to make a commission by referring readers or visitors to a business’s particular product or service. The affiliate marketer promotes this product through their web channels—blogs, websites, email lists, etc.—and earns a piece of the profit from each sale they make. The sales are tracked via affiliate links from one website to another.

To start your journey in affiliate marketing, the first step is to choose your niche. This is the area in which you have knowledge or passion and are likely to be able to promote products effectively. Research affiliate programs within this niche to find products that offer a good commission, have a solid reputation and align with your target audience.

The next step is to build a website. Your website is your tool for promoting affiliate products and services. This is where you’ll publish the content that includes your affiliate links. Remember to put your audience first. Provide value and relevant content, and only promote products that meet their needs and that you believe in.

Once your website is set up, you’ll want to attract traffic. This can be done through various digital marketing strategies such as SEO, content marketing, social media advertising, and email marketing. As traffic to your website increases, so does the potential for affiliate link clicks and, subsequently, revenue.

Lastly, you’ll want to continuously monitor your performance and optimize your strategies. Use analytics tools to understand which strategies are driving traffic and sales. Remember that it’s a process that requires time, so remain patient and keep refining your approach. With dedication and persistence, you can successfully start and grow your affiliate marketing business as a beginner.

Benefits of affiliate marketing

Affiliate marketing offers several significant benefits that make it an attractive venture for beginners. One of the most compelling advantages of affiliate marketing is its low entry barrier. It requires minimal financial investment to start, and you don’t need to develop or produce your products.

Moreover, affiliate marketing allows you to operate globally, promoting products to a worldwide audience. This provides a tremendous opportunity to scale your business beyond local customers.

Another benefit is the freedom and flexibility it offers. As a successful affiliate marketer, you can work from anywhere, set your hours, and decide how much effort you want to invest. This autonomy makes it an excellent choice for individuals looking for a flexible business opportunity.

Furthermore, affiliate marketing is performance-based, meaning you earn a commission for actual sales made through your affiliate link. This payment model ensures you get paid for your efforts and can be particularly rewarding for those who put in the time and energy to understand their audience and promote the right products.

Lastly, affiliate marketing provides you with the opportunity to learn valuable digital marketing skills. As you navigate through SEO, content marketing, email marketing, and social media promotion, you’ll acquire a broad range of skills that are highly valuable in today’s digital world.

affiliate marketing

Types of affiliate programs

Affiliate programs can be broadly categorized into two types: high-paying, low-volume affiliate programs, and low-paying, high-volume affiliate programs. High-paying, low-volume affiliate programs typically offer a significant commission for each sale but have a smaller audience base. These programs are often associated with niche products or services, such as professional training courses or high-end electronics. This type of affiliate program can be highly profitable if you have a targeted audience interested in the niche product.

On the other hand, low-paying, high-volume affiliate programs revolve around products or services with mass appeal but offer a smaller commission per sale. Examples of such programs include Amazon Associates or other large e-commerce affiliate programs. Although the commission per sale is relatively low, the sheer volume of potential sales can lead to significant earnings.

Another type of affiliate program to consider is high-paying, high-volume affiliate programs. These are relatively rare but highly lucrative. They exist in spaces where customer acquisition is very competitive, and companies are willing to pay generously for new leads or customers. Examples might include credit card sign-ups or high-end fashion retailers.

Lastly, there are residual income affiliate programs. These programs pay out a recurring income for a one-time effort. Usually, these come in the form of services or subscriptions where customers pay a regular recurring fee. Affiliates receive a recurring percentage of that fee for the lifetime of the customer.

Choosing the right type of affiliate program depends on your audience, your level of commitment, and your specific interests. To succeed in affiliate marketing, you need to align your choice of program with the needs and interests of your audience.

Best affiliate marketing programs

Diving into the world of affiliate marketing as a novice can feel overwhelming, but the choices you make at the outset can have significant impacts on your journey ahead. Chief among these decisions is the selection of the right affiliate marketing program. This program forms the backbone of your affiliate marketing activities, providing you with a platform to learn the ropes, grow your skills, and ultimately generate income. Therefore, the importance of making a wise selection cannot be overstated.

Affiliate marketing programs are essentially a bridge connecting marketers and businesses. On one side, businesses seeking broader market reach offer up their products or services. On the other side, marketers leverage their platforms to promote these offerings to their audience. When a follower or reader purchases via the marketer’s affiliate link, the marketer earns a commission. This simple concept is the cornerstone of affiliate marketing.

Here are some of the best platforms for affiliate marketing:

Impact Radius

Impact Radius

The Impact Radius Affiliate Partner Program offered by is a lucrative opportunity designed for individuals and entities who hold significant influence and connections within the business community. The program’s core objective is to utilize the networks of its participants to introduce and connect new brands to’s innovative partnership automation technology, thereby fostering new customer acquisitions for the platform. Specifically targeting thought leaders, publications, superconnectors, and anyone in contact with brands that could benefit from enhanced partnership programs, this program is tailor-made for those at the forefront of business networking.

Participants in the program are encouraged to use their influence and connections to promote through various channels such as emails, social media, and professional forums. The incentive for doing so is a rewarding system where referral partners earn a percentage of the revenue for every new paying customer they bring to Joining this program not only offers a financial incentive but also allows referral partners to add significant value to their networks by introducing them to leading partnership automation technology, aiding in their business growth. Moreover, participants gain exclusive access to partnership education resources, cementing their status as experts in the partnership domain.’s platform, with its advanced Partnership Automation™ technology, stands out in the rapidly evolving sales and advertising landscape. It facilitates the discovery and engagement of publishers at scale, thereby supporting a complete partnership lifecycle. For those interested, the program details about eligibility, the process of joining, referral submissions, terms of the partnership, and tracking mechanisms are conveniently laid out in the FAQ section.

Amazon Associates

amazon associates

As the world’s largest online retailer, Amazon offers an enormous number of products to promote. Its affiliate program, Amazon Associates, is one of the most popular due to its ease of use and vast product range. This program provides an ideal starting point for beginners due to its simple and user-friendly system.

With millions of products to choose from, affiliates have the flexibility to promote items that resonate best with their audience. However, it’s important to note that the commission rates are relatively low compared to other programs, typically ranging from 1% to 10%.

Despite this, many new affiliate marketers find the sheer quantity of available products and the trust associated with Amazon’s brand name to be valuable starting points in their affiliate marketing journey.



One of the most well-established affiliate marketing platforms, ClickBank specializes in digital information products, offering some of the highest commission rates in the industry. Many of these rates can be as high as 75%. This makes it an excellent choice for beginners who have a strong interest in information marketing.

The platform focuses on providing a plethora of digital products, allowing affiliate marketers to align their promotional efforts with their audience’s interests. Given its emphasis on high commission rates, it is a particularly attractive option for those starting their journey in affiliate marketing.

CJ Affiliate

cj affiliate

Formerly known as Commission Junction, CJ Affiliate is a broad network that offers a wide variety of products to promote across different industries. It’s renowned for its transparency in performance metrics that provide valuable insight into earnings, view rates, and other essential data.

This feature is incredibly beneficial for beginners in affiliate marketing as it enables them to track their progress and understand the effectiveness of their strategies. Like Amazon Associates, CJ Affiliate also offers a vast product range, giving affiliates the flexibility to choose products that best resonate with their audience.

However, it is worth noting that CJ Affiliate has a more rigorous approval process compared to other platforms; thus, it may not be the most accessible option for those just starting.


A prominent player in the affiliate marketing sphere, ShareASale offers a comprehensive selection of products across various niches, ensuring that affiliates can find offerings that align with their specific market focus. Its user-friendly interface makes navigation and management of affiliate activities seamless, which is particularly beneficial for beginners finding their foothold in affiliate marketing.

Furthermore, ShareASale provides an array of tools designed to aid affiliates in their promotional efforts. These tools range from real-time tracking of clicks and sales to customizable link options that help enhance the overall effectiveness of their marketing strategies. With its extensive product range and robust toolset, ShareASale is an excellent platform for beginners looking to venture into affiliate marketing.

Remember, the key to successful affiliate marketing is to align your platform choice with your audience’s interests. Take the time to understand the demographics and preferences of your audience before choosing a platform. This will ensure that the products you promote are relevant and appealing to those who follow your content.

Steps to start affiliate marketing

how to start affiliate marketing

Choose Your Niche

The first step in starting an affiliate program is selecting a niche. A niche pertains to a specialized segment of the market that you’re particularly interested in or knowledgeable about. It’s essential to choose a niche you’re passionate about rather than just one that’s profitable. This will make the entire process more enjoyable and increase your chances of success.

Build a Website or Blog

The next step is to create a website or blog. This will serve as your platform for promoting products and reaching your target audience. There are various website builders and blogging platforms available today that make it easy to build a professional-looking site or blog, even if you have no prior experience or technical skills.

Join an Affiliate Marketing Network

Once you have your website or blog set up, you’ll need to join an affiliate marketing network. This is where you’ll find products to promote. The networks mentioned above – Amazon Associates, ClickBank, CJ Affiliate, and ShareASale – are all excellent choices for beginners.

Create Quality Content

After joining an affiliate network, the next step is to start creating high-quality content. This could be in the form of blog posts, reviews, guides, or any other type of content that’s relevant to your niche. The key is to provide value to your audience and build trust, which in turn will make them more likely to purchase the products you recommend.

Promote Your Affiliate Products

Finally, once you’ve built up a library of content and established some trust with your audience, you can start promoting your affiliate products. This can be done through a variety of methods, such as including links in your content, creating product reviews, or promoting products on social media. Always remember the key to successful affiliate marketing is promoting products that are relevant and useful to your audience.

Additional Tips

affiliate marketing tips

Here are some additional tips to help you get started with affiliate marketing:

  • Choose a niche that you’re passionate about and have knowledge in. This will make it easier for you to create content and promote products that resonate with your audience.
  • Be transparent about your affiliate links. It’s important to disclose when you’re promoting products through affiliate links so your audience knows and trusts your recommendations.
  • Continuously track and analyze your performance. This will help you understand what’s working and what may need improvement in your affiliate marketing strategy.
  • Stay up to date with the latest trends, products, and developments in your niche. This will help you stay relevant and provide valuable content to your audience.
  • Don’t be afraid to try new things and experiment with different strategies. What works for one affiliate marketers may not work for another, so it’s important to find what works best for you.
  • Always prioritize providing value to your audience over making a sale. This will help you build trust and establish yourself as an authority in your niche.

Best practices for success in affiliate marketing

The first step in excelling at affiliate marketing for beginners is to understand the audience’s needs meticulously. Research their interests, preferences, and problems. Your affiliate marketing efforts will be most effective when the products you promote provide a solution to the issues your audience faces. It’s not just about promoting a product; it’s about promoting the right product.

Next, focus on building trustworthy and authentic relationships with your audience. Trust is the cornerstone of affiliate marketing. Be genuine in your product recommendations, only endorsing those products and services you truly believe in. This sincerity will shine through in your marketing, making your audience more likely to trust your suggestions and use your affiliate links.

Furthermore, consistency is key in affiliate marketing. Regularly produce high-quality content that adds value to your audience. This could be in the form of blog posts, social media updates, podcasts, or videos. This not only keeps your audience engaged but also attracts more traffic to your platform, thus increasing the chances of people using your affiliate links.

Lastly, be patient. Affiliate marketing success doesn’t happen overnight. It requires persistence, consistency, and time. Continuously refine and optimize your strategies based on what your performance data shows.

affiliate marketing best practices

Tips for driving traffic to your site

Attracting traffic to your site is a crucial component of successful affiliate marketing. Implementing a solid search engine optimization (SEO) strategy can significantly increase your site’s visibility in search results, thereby driving more organic traffic. Start by performing keyword research to identify the terms your target audience is searching for, and optimize your content accordingly.

Additionally, aim to produce high-quality, unique content that provides value to your readers. This not only improves your search engine rankings but also encourages visitors to stay on your site longer, increasing the likelihood of them clicking on your affiliate links.

Another effective method to drive traffic is through social media marketing. Actively engage with your audience across various social platforms like Facebook, Instagram, Twitter, and LinkedIn. Regularly share valuable content, respond to comments, and participate in discussions to build strong relationships with your followers. Social media boosts your brand awareness, drives traffic to your site, and ultimately increases your affiliate marketing sales.

Email marketing is another powerful tool for driving traffic. Send regular newsletters to your subscribers that provide valuable content related to your niche and subtly promote your affiliate products. Cautiously crafted emails can help nurture relationships with your audience, remind them about your site, and encourage them to click on your affiliate links. Remember, the goal is to provide value first and promote it second.

Finally, consider pay-per-click (PPC) advertising to drive targeted traffic to your site quickly. With PPC, you bid on keywords related to your niche, and your ads appear in the sponsored results section of search engine results pages. PPC can be an effective way to drive traffic, but it requires careful management and optimization to ensure a good return on your investment.

Remember, more traffic means more potential customers and, thus, a higher chance of generating affiliate sales. Therefore, continually test, refine, and optimize your traffic-driving strategies to enhance the effectiveness of your involved affiliate marketing efforts.

How to track results and optimize campaigns

It’s crucial to track the performance of your affiliate marketing efforts to understand what’s working and what’s not. Utilize analytics tools like Google Analytics to track your website traffic, conversions, and user behavior.

Additionally, most affiliate programs provide performance dashboards where you can monitor your clicks, conversions, and revenue. By analyzing this data, you can identify your top-performing products and successful strategies and use this information to optimize your affiliate marketing campaigns.

Equally important is A/B testing, a method of comparing two versions of a webpage or other user experience to see which performs better. This involves making a change in one element of your web page (e.g., the color of a call-to-action button) and comparing it with the current design. The version that gives a higher conversion rate wins.

Optimizing your campaigns is an ongoing process. It involves tweaking various elements like your website design, content, SEO strategies, and PPC campaigns based on the insights you gain from tracking and testing. Remember to make one change at a time so you know exactly what caused the change in performance. Optimization is all about refining your strategies and tactics based on data to increase the efficiency and profitability of your unattached affiliate marketing efforts.

Strategies for boosting your income through affiliate marketing

The first strategy to boost your income through affiliate marketing is to diversify your affiliate portfolio. Stick to promoting products or services that align with your niche or the content of your website or blog. However, don’t rely solely on a single affiliate marketing work. Partner up with multiple vendors to secure various streams of income. This not only minimizes risk but also gives you the opportunity to learn what works best for your audience and what doesn’t.

Building strong relationships with your audience is another key strategy. In the world of affiliate marketing, trust plays a vital role. Focus on producing high-quality, valuable content that addresses the needs and interests of your audience. This builds credibility, and when your audience trusts you, they are more likely to take your recommendations and click on your affiliate links. Additionally, develop an engaging email marketing strategy. Email marketing is a powerful tool for driving traffic to your affiliate links and boosting conversions.

Finally, consider utilizing SEO and PPC advertising to increase your visibility and attract more traffic to your site. SEO involves optimizing your website and content to rank higher in search engine results, thus attracting more organic traffic. PPC advertising, on the other hand, involves paying for ad placements on platforms like Google AdWords. While SEO takes time to deliver results, PPC can drive immediate traffic to your site. Both, when utilized effectively, can significantly boost your affiliate income.

Remember, success in affiliate marketing doesn’t come overnight. It requires patience, learning, and constant optimization of your strategies. As you gain experience, keep exploring new affiliate marketing trends and tools that can help you stay ahead of the competition and maximize your income.


What is affiliate marketing, and how does it work?

Affiliate marketing is a performance-based marketing strategy where an affiliate earns a commission for promoting someone else’s products or services. The affiliate promotes the product on their platform, and if a sale occurs through their referral link, they earn a portion of the profits.

How can a beginner start in affiliate marketing?

For beginners, the first step is to choose a niche or industry you’re passionate about. Next, find products or services within that niche to promote. Join a related affiliate marketing program, create a website or blog, and start creating high-quality, valuable content promoting your affiliate products.

What are some strategies for building trust with my audience?

Trust can be built through consistently providing high-quality, valuable content that addresses the needs and interests of your audience. Be transparent about your affiliate networks, engage with your audience through comments and emails, and always put their needs and interests first.

Should I focus on SEO or PPC advertising for my affiliate marketing?

Both SEO and PPC advertising can be effective. SEO helps your site rank higher in search engine results over time, attracting more organic traffic. PPC advertising can drive immediate traffic to your site but at a cost. It’s best to balance both strategies depending on your goals and budget.

What are some tools or resources for affiliate marketing?

Tools such as Google Analytics, SEMRush, and Ahrefs can help with SEO and market research. Affiliate tracking software can help manage and track your affiliate website and links. Email marketing tools like Mailchimp can help with audience engagement. Always stay updated with the latest trends and tools in affiliate marketing. Attend conferences webinars, and join online communities to stay informed.


I hope this guide has provided you with valuable insights and tips on how to start affiliate marketing as a beginner. Remember, the key is to find your passion, choose the right niche, create high-quality content, and engage with your audience. With dedication and hard work, you can build a successful affiliate marketing business. Keep learning, stay updated, and always put the needs of your audience first.

Related Posts

Picture of Cam Morales
Cam Morales

Cam is the Founder & CEO of, Bix and EcomUpstart - he built two 7 figure businesses since he started his entrepreneurship journey in 2016. He now helps others launch ecommerce stores and other online businesses.

Leave a Reply